gpt4 book ai didi

php - iOS;将图像从 UIImageView 发布到 PHP

转载 作者:行者123 更新时间:2023-11-30 13:05:12 26 4
gpt4 key购买 nike

我正在使用 Xcode 和 Swift 开发 iOS 应用程序。

我通常使用此代码将数据 POST 到 PHP:

let requestImage = NSMutableURLRequest(URL: NSURL(string: "http://example.com/postData.php")!)
requestData.HTTPMethod = "POST"
let postStringImage = "name=\(name.text!)&age=\(age.text!)"
requestData.HTTPBody = postStringImage.dataUsingEncoding(NSUTF8StringEncoding)

现在我想将 UIImageView 中的图像发布到 PHP:我可以简单地做这样的事情吗?代码:

let requestImage = NSMutableURLRequest(URL: NSURL(string: "http://example.com/postImage.php")!)
requestData.HTTPMethod = "POST"
let postStringImage = "image=\(MyImage)"
requestData.HTTPBody = postStringImage.dataUsingEncoding(NSUTF8StringEncoding)

我需要做什么才能使其正常工作?

顺便说一句:

我使用此代码通过浏览器测试我的 PHP 脚本:

<form action="postImage.php" method="post" enctype="multipart/form-data">
<input type="file" name="fileToUpload">
<input type="submit" value="Upload Image">
</form>

最佳答案

您有一个接受 multipart/form-data 的 PHP 脚本。因此,您需要将 POST 请求设为 multipart/form-data。试试这个例子:

https://stackoverflow.com/a/24252378/2441775

如果您有任何疑问,请随时再次请求。我会尽力回答。

关于php - iOS;将图像从 UIImageView 发布到 PHP,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39476590/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com